Enrollment Refund Policy
All courses dropped within 24 hours of the original enrollment date will receive a full refund. All courses dropped after 24 hours but within 10 business days of the original enrollment date will be refunded minus a $20 processing fee. The course materials must be returned to NDCDE within 30 days of the date the course was dropped. If the course materials are not returned, the market cost will be billed and invoiced to the party responsible for payment. Upon receiving all course materials for the dropped courses, the NDCDE invoice will be voided, and the remaining amount will be refunded. If you wish to drop a course, please complete an Enrollment Drop Request form, found here on our website.
All courses dropped after the first 10 days will receive no refund.
Course Completion Policy
- NDCDE courses are designed to be completed in one semester (20 weeks).
- NDCDE courses are open to withdrawal up to ten weeks after enrollment with no grade issued. If you wish to drop a course, please complete an Enrollment Drop Request form, found here on our website.
Failure to drop, withdraw, or complete a course within the guidelines detailed above will result in a final course grade based on the work completed.
Students who do not submit at least one assignment during the first two weeks of a course will be dropped from the course.
